    I sent you a PM with the answer. Obviously, I've just played the LITE version and was surprised that it's a really fun puzzle game of sorts. I'd like to have the full version because I think this makes for an ideal iPod Touch game, as levels seem to be short, but pretty challenging so that it can also keep you playing for a long time :) Apart from that it's nice to see such a little but still unique, good game in a sea of match-3 puzzle games, Flight Control clones and all sorts of "casual games". Lunarcy is clearly similar to Lunar Lander and other classics like that, but then again very different in how it actually works. That's really nice.

    While we're at it, I found that the side thrusters react too sensitively. If I just want to adjust the ship slightly I have to be extremely careful not to press the button for that little moment too long, otherwise the ship will spin out of control. I think it would be better if you had to press the button longer to make the ship go that fast. Also, I thought it was irritating that using the "stop" button still drains fuel, even if the ship isn't rotating, anyway.
    While the game seems to be very (nicely) difficult, anyway, I think if those two things were improved it would be more enjoyable. At least that's my impression from playing the 4 LITE levels.
